Blast in louden county. Debris rained down along old ox road and oak grove road in sterling. Northern Virginia Bureau chief was first reporter there on the scene and has our report. Reporter this Security Camera video shows what it looks like when a big rock flying like a missile crashes into a building. And this is the damage left behind when another rock smashes into a house. Dwight brooks got a call and raced to his parents home to find this huge rock blasted from a quarry a half mile away. Tore through the roof and landed on a bed right next to a pillow. At an angle. You can see where it landed. And thats quite a bit of force to come through that roof and in there. Reporter brooks brother was sleeping on the other bed right under the spot where the rock came shooting inside. He was cut by debris and required eight stitches at the hospital. If it had hit him, the damage could have been must worst. He could have been killed. Reporter down the street were more damage from more rocks. I thought it was a real hard second concussion blast coming from it. Never in my wildest dreams though did i picture id see the size rocks we saw that came through the window. Reporter take another look at the Security Camera video from fairfax autoparts in slow motion. The rock comes flying takes out the top of a no parking sign then hits the asphalt and bounces off so hard into the building the windows explode. You can only sit back and say only by the grace of god did nobody get hurt out of this thing with rocks flying through the air. Reporter outside in the parking lot, at least a half dozen cars also got blasted from smaller rocks. Huge dents now crease the metal. Inspectors from Winchester Building supply the blasting company, and the department of labor were out on the scene to try to figure out what went wrong. The news4 iteam revealing the daily food fight for d. C. s food trucks. Even after they get their permits and licenses some trucks had to wage a constant battle to get their spots. As Scott Macfarlane shows us you might be the one paying the price because of it. Reporter it all looks so tasty and trendy. This is the lunch crowd behind the headquarters of the federal Aviation Administration in southwest d. C. The food covers the grill and the trucks cover maryland avenue. Before you arrive the food fight begins. The trucks are hitting each other. And its becoming madness. Reporter the trucks the winners for this months lottery race each other for a parking spot. They say theyre not allowed to park here before 10 30 a. M. So at 10 31 a. M. , the jockeying begins as our cameras saw. If one person crossing knots looking, this is a disaster happening. Reporter sam operates the kebab square truck and said hes seen trucks hit by others white competing for space. Our cameras spotted a close call between a truck and a driver. Then we saw something else. Im parked illegally here. Reporter other drivers, tourists local workers getting swept up by tow trucks. Parking signs show these meters are off to allow space for the food trucks. We watched tow operators circling the block then moving in after parking attendants bro tickets. The no parking signs are confusing, drivers say. And in some cases they stand a distance from the parking meters which have no warning sign. It makes me angry. Reporter this woman says visitors unfamiliar to the signs or rules are falling victim. I dont think its fair whats happening to the people coming into this town spending their money, coming back to not have their vehicle there. Reporter but not every vehicle is towed to clear space for the trucks. This white van was parked in the middle of the pack. The parking attendant says she cant ticket it she cant touch it. Its a federal government vehicle. Taking a spot that food truck operators pay 150 a month to reserve. You can see over your shoulder theres a government truck in one of your spots. Absolutely. Reporter that happen a lot . Every day. Reporter the driver a woman wearing smithsonian security clothing returns to her van midday. Scott with channel 4, you know youre parked in a food truck area here . A spokeswoman says smithsonian workers driving smithsonian vehicles cannot park in no parking zones. They must follow parking regulations and all parking signs. City records show about 400 cars having towed from this small stretch of maryland avenue just since january. And thats nearly half of all cars towed from food truck zones citywide this year. Scott macfarlane, news4 iteam. The maryland Mens Lacrosse Team since 1975 seven appearances in the National Championship game. Seven losses. This week history repeated itself for maryland. The terps took on denver. Maryland never recovered from a hot start. The pioneers ultimately defeating maryland 105. Its denvers first mens lacrosse title in school history. They became the First Team West of the mississippi to win it all. But maryland lacrosse isnt going home completely empty handed. The terps womens team defeated unc. Maryland launched a furious second half comeback to take home the title. Its the 12th ncaa championship for the woMens Lacrosse Team. Love it. Well gumbo, fried chicken, a couple of cold drafts.
